Nestled in the heart of northwest Oklahoma, Waynoka, OK is a charming small town that offers a unique blend of rich history, vibrant community spirit, and stunning natural beauty. Located just off U.S. Route 283, this picturesque town is easily accessible and serves as a gateway to the surrounding landscapes of the Great Plains.
One of the most notable characteristics of Waynoka, OK is its deep-rooted connection to the railroad industry. Established in the late 19th century, the town was originally a bustling hub for the Santa Fe Railroad, which played a significant role in its development. Today, visitors can explore the remnants of this rich history at the Waynoka Historical Museum, where fascinating exhibits showcase the town's past and its evolution over the years.

For outdoor enthusiasts, Waynoka, OK offers an array of recreational opportunities. The nearby Little Sahara State Park is a must-visit destination, featuring stunning sand dunes that are perfect for off-roading, hiking, and camping. The park's unique landscape provides a playground for adventure seekers and nature lovers alike, making it a popular spot for families and friends to gather and enjoy the great outdoors.
